#12131b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12131b is composed of 7.1% red, 7.5%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 29.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 89.4% black. It has a hue angle of 233.3 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 8.8%. #12131b color hex could be obtained by blending #242636 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#12131b color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#12131b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12131b has RGB values of R:18, G:19,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.89. Its decimal value is 1184539.

Shades and Tints of #12131b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f7f7f9 is the lightest one.
